Leaf2.0 introduces a carbon-negative bioprocessing technology targeting the cosmetics, pharmaceutical, and chemical industries. Utilizing patented nano electrocatalysts (M-NOLI), this platform efficiently converts CO2 into valuable chemicals like syngas, formate, and acetate at the nanoparticle level. This process is designed to provide a carbon-negative solution, significantly impacting over half of the global bioprocess technologies and a substantial majority of the chemical industry.
The innovative approach of Leaf2.0 involves the deployment of micro-plants to localize manufacturing, addressing supply chain and environmental challenges. These micro-plants operate on a novel principle, using water, air, and sunlight for the majority of their feedstock needs and achieving zero carbon emissions across all stages of the product lifecycle, from manufacturing through usage to disposal.
